Founding Partner Jerry Lehocky Reappointed to Disciplinary Board of the Pennsylvania Supreme Court

Jerry Lehocky, Esq.founding partner of Pond Lehocky Giordano, has been appointed for the second time to the Disciplinary Board of the Pennsylvania Supreme Court, beginning December 14, 2020. His previous appointment was instated on February 1, 2018. This appointment is for a four-year term. 

Lehocky is a founding partner of Pond Lehocky. A 1985 graduate of Temple University School of Law, he has been a litigator of workers’ compensation and Social Security disability since being admitted to practice. Initially, he represented employers and insurance companies. However, since 1991, he has represented claimants exclusively. He is currently serving a three-year term as a member of the Disciplinary Board of the Pennsylvania Supreme Court. He is also a former president of the Pennsylvania Association for Justice, the first workers’ compensation attorney to hold that position.
